维基辞典粤语短语
原书拼音: /pɐt̚⁵ kiːn³³ kuːn⁵⁵ t͡sʰɔːi̯²¹ pɐt̚⁵ tiːu̯²² lɵy̯²²/
to refuse to be convinced until one is faced with the grim reality; tenacious, resolute or pertinacious in one's pursuit of a goal despite obstacles or advice
